要在Linux服务器上连接MySQL数据库,请按照以下步骤操作:
sudo apt-get update
sudo apt-get install mysql-server mysql-client
在基于RPM的系统(如CentOS、Fedora)上,可以使用以下命令安装:
sudo yum install mysql-server mysql-client
sudo systemctl status mysql
如果MySQL服务未启动,可以使用以下命令启动:
sudo systemctl start mysql
为了确保MySQL服务在系统启动时自动运行,可以使用以下命令:
sudo systemctl enable mysql
mysql
命令行客户端连接到MySQL数据库。默认情况下,MySQL服务使用root
用户和/var/run/mysqld/mysqld.sock
套接字文件。使用以下命令连接:mysql -u root -S /var/run/mysqld/mysqld.sock
如果您的MySQL配置了远程访问,您还可以使用主机名或IP地址以及端口号进行连接。例如:
mysql -u root -h 192.168.1.100 -P 3306 -p
在上面的命令中,-h
参数指定了主机名或IP地址,-P
参数指定了端口号(默认为3306),-p
参数表示需要输入密码。
exit
或quit
,然后按回车键。注意:出于安全考虑,请确保您的MySQL配置文件(通常位于/etc/mysql/my.cnf
或/etc/my.cnf
)中的bind-address
设置正确。如果您希望允许来自任何IP地址的连接,可以将其设置为0.0.0.0
。但是,请注意这样做可能会带来安全风险,因此建议仅允许来自可信IP地址的连接。
没有搜到相关的文章